Eugenia Adobea Addo

Director of Communications

A communications leader with over eight years of experience spanning strategy, content, digital platforms, Eugenia has experience in stakeholder engagement within mission-driven public institutions. 

As Director of Communications for Project Yananai, she leads the global communications function – shaping the organisation's brand, managing media relations, producing compelling donor and partner content, and overseeing digital presence and internal communications across the Global Executive Leadership Team and National Management Teams.

Eugenia brings a distinguished track record of building communications functions from the ground up. She currently serves as Head of Communications and Media Team for a national public institution, where she leads a five-member team and founded the organisation's official social media presence, building its Facebook and LinkedIn pages from zero. She led the communications strategy and full-scale digital rollout for a flagship national development fund, including its presentation to international investors at a major investment summit, personally developing content and messaging to articulate the fund's value proposition. She also coordinated a national capacity-building programme for 522 district-level officials, project-managing communications materials, logistics, timelines, and media coverage across multiple stakeholders.

Previously, Eugenia headed a statutory disclosure function, administering public-information obligations under national law, and authored and published the institution's Information Manual – a public-facing governance document formalising proactive disclosure practice. She also supported public information request handling for a national health institution and held business development and client acquisition roles, where she honed her skills in market research, relationship-building, and audience-tailored communications.

Eugenia holds an MA in Development Communication and is trained in AI-driven digital marketing and strategic communication. She has completed formal training in building high-performing teams at the Civil Service College in London and holds certifications in public relations and access to information law. She is passionate about using strategic communications to amplify impact, build trust, and tell the story of community-led transformation.
